Silence is a historical novel by Shusaku Endo, a Catholic Japanese, making his perspective unique in the country that primarily practice Shinto and Buddhism.

Brilliantly written. Difficult read--first 4 chapters are first person POV thru the medium of letters, then it switches to 3rd person. Endo telegraphs nothing as he pilots his characters through turbulent times and theology to a powerful and spiritually fulfilling ending.
